Intimacy Versus Isolation
A stage in Erik Erikson's theory of psychosocial development focusing on young adults' struggle to form close relationships and emotional bonds.
Normative-Stage
A concept in developmental psychology referring to universally experienced phases or stages across the lifespan that align with biological or social expectations.
Personality Model
A theoretical framework used to describe, explain, and predict an individual's personality traits and how these influence behavior and interaction.
Erikson
Refers to Erik Erikson, a psychologist known for his theory on the psychological development of human beings, characterized by eight stages from infancy to adulthood.
